Job Description: Public Area Attendant in Bloomsbury

We are seeking a diligent and attentive Public Area Attendant to join our hospitality team in the vibrant district of Bloomsbury. The ideal candidate will be responsible for maintaining the cleanliness and appearance of public areas within our establishments, ensuring guests experience a welcoming and pristine environment.

Main Responsibilities

  • Maintain cleanliness and order in all public areas, including lobbies, restrooms, corridors, elevators, and lounges.
  • Dust and polish surfaces, vacuum carpets, and mop floors according to the defined cleaning schedule or as needed.
  • Empty trash receptacles and ensure proper separation and disposal of recycling materials.
  • Conduct regular inspections of public areas for maintenance needs, reporting any issues to the supervisor or maintenance department.
  • Assist with the setup, takedown, and cleaning of public spaces for events or functions.
  • Replenish supplies in restrooms such as soap, toilet paper, and towels.
  • Adhere to health and safety standards and use proper cleaning techniques and equipment.
  • Ensure furniture and décor in public areas are in proper placement and good condition.
  • Work discreetly to avoid disturbing guests and respect their privacy.

Required Skills & Qualifications

  • Good communication skills and the ability to follow written and verbal instructions.
  • Attention to detail and a high standard of cleanliness and hygiene.
  • Physical stamina and mobility to perform general cleaning tasks.
  • Ability to work effectively both independently and as part of a team.
  • Knowledge of cleaning chemicals and equipment, plus safety practices related to cleaning.
  • Customer service-oriented mindset.

Experience

  • Previous experience as a Public Area Attendant, Cleaner, or in a similar role within the hospitality industry is preferred but not essential.
  • On-the-job training may be provided for candidates demonstrating a strong willingness to learn.

Understanding the Job Profile of a Public Area Attendant

Public Area Attendants, also known as Public Area Cleaners or Public Space Operatives, are tasked with maintaining the cleanliness and aesthetic appeal of public spaces within buildings and venues. This includes lobbies, restrooms, hallways, and other communal areas. They ensure that these spaces are free from debris, waste is properly disposed of, and any necessary cleaning is routinely performed.

The role may also involve restocking supplies, performing minor maintenance tasks, and reporting any damages or security concerns to the appropriate authorities. In Bloomsbury, Public Area Attendants may work in a variety of settings, such as hotels, museums, universities, and even public parks.

Professional Development and Growth

Public Area Attendant jobs often serve as entry points into the hospitality and facilities management industries. In Bloomsbury, where such sectors are thriving, career advancements are entirely possible. Those who excel in their roles may find opportunities to move into supervisory positions or specialize in areas like waste management or environmental services. Participating in additional training and certifications can further one’s knowledge and open the door to more advanced employment prospects.

Professional associations such as the British Institute of Cleaning Science provide certifications and training courses that can significantly enhance a Public Area Attendant’s skill set and desirability to employers. Attaining these credentials not only boosts your resume but also equips you with the latest practices and technologies in the field of facilities maintenance.

What hours may I be expected to work as a public area attendant in Bloomsquare?

Public area attendant roles in Bloomsbury may require flexible hours, including early mornings, late evenings, weekends, and public holidays. Part-time, full-time, and shift work are all common in this field. Typically, your schedule will depend on the employer’s needs and the operational hours of the facility you are working for.
